THE HON'BLE SRI JUSTICE JOYMALYA BAGCHI AND THE HON'BLE SRI JUSTICE A.V.SESHA SAI

WRIT PETITION Nos.16181, 16192, 16239, 16424, 16507, 16530 and 16531 of 2020

(Taken up through video conferencing)

COMMON ORDER: (Per Hon'ble Sri Justice A.V.Sesha Sai)

Since all these writ petitions are similar and the petitioners herein share a similar grievance, this Court deems it appropriate to dispose of all these writ petitions by way of this common order.

  1. Followed by show cause notices issued by the respondent authorities and submission of explanations by the petitioners herein, the respondent authorities issued the impugned notices. A perusal of the material available on record discloses that as a sequel to the orders passed by the National Green Tribunal, the respondent authorities initiated the impugned action.

  2. This Court granted interim stay of further proceedings in pursuance of the impugned notices. Since the main issue is pending consideration before the National Green Tribunal, keeping in view the submissions of Sri K.Chidambaram, learned counsel, representing Ms. Tirumala Rani and Sri V.Surendra Reddy, learned Standing Counsel for Andhra Pradesh Pollution Control Board, this Court deems it appropriate to dispose of these writ petitions, leaving it open for the petitioners herein to approach the National Green Tribunal with necessary applications and for appropriate reliefs, if not already approached, for consideration of the same by the National Green Tribunal. So as to enable the petitioners herein to avail the said remedy, we deem it apposite to continue the

interim orders granted by this Court for a period of four weeks from today, subject to any order passed by the National Green Tribunal.

With these observations, these Writ Petitions are disposed of. No order as to costs.

As a sequel, Miscellaneous Petitions, if any, pending in these Writ Petitions shall stand closed.
